Light Cigarettes Could Carry Heavy Price Tag for Philip Morris
Boston, MA: A landmark decision brought down by the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court, has paved the way for smokers to sue cigarette manufacturers for misleading advertising. The ruling, announced in the media March 19, effectively green lights a 10-year-old lawsuit against cigarette giant Philip Morris...
